Changes in kernel/generic/include/udebug/udebug_ops.h [b7fd2a0:9d58539] in mainline
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
kernel/generic/include/udebug/udebug_ops.h
rb7fd2a0 r9d58539 37 37 38 38 #include <ipc/ipc.h> 39 #include <proc/thread.h>40 #include <stdbool.h>41 #include <stddef.h>42 39 43 errno_t udebug_begin(call_t *call, bool *active);44 errno_t udebug_end(void);45 errno_t udebug_set_evmask(udebug_evmask_t mask);40 int udebug_begin(call_t *call); 41 int udebug_end(void); 42 int udebug_set_evmask(udebug_evmask_t mask); 46 43 47 errno_t udebug_go(thread_t *t, call_t *call);48 errno_t udebug_stop(thread_t *t, call_t *call);44 int udebug_go(thread_t *t, call_t *call); 45 int udebug_stop(thread_t *t, call_t *call); 49 46 50 errno_t udebug_thread_read(void **buffer, size_t buf_size, size_t *stored,47 int udebug_thread_read(void **buffer, size_t buf_size, size_t *stored, 51 48 size_t *needed); 52 errno_t udebug_name_read(char **data, size_t *data_size);53 errno_t udebug_args_read(thread_t *t, void **buffer);49 int udebug_name_read(char **data, size_t *data_size); 50 int udebug_args_read(thread_t *t, void **buffer); 54 51 55 errno_t udebug_regs_read(thread_t *t, void **buffer);52 int udebug_regs_read(thread_t *t, void **buffer); 56 53 57 errno_t udebug_mem_read(sysarg_t uspace_addr, size_t n, void **buffer);54 int udebug_mem_read(sysarg_t uspace_addr, size_t n, void **buffer); 58 55 59 56 #endif
Note:
See TracChangeset
for help on using the changeset viewer.